Tengo una interfaz de audio externa (M-audio fast track c400). Para que mi macbook lo reconozca (se muestra en la configuración de audio / midi), tengo que reiniciar, lo cual es una molestia. He tenido otras interfaces de audio m que se detectaron automáticamente cuando se conectaron, y estoy bastante seguro de que esta debería ser la misma. La mayoría de las publicaciones en Internet sugieren actualizar el sistema operativo o el software / firmware para el dispositivo. He hecho todo eso sin suerte. Actualmente estoy ejecutando OS X 10.8.5.
¿Hay alguna manera de obligar a OS X a recargar el dispositivo? Preferiblemente algún vudú de línea de comando que podría disparar rápidamente cuando fuera necesario o envolver en un pequeño script de shell.
Editar: Progreso ..
El problema parece estar solucionado ahora ... No estoy seguro de cómo lo siguiente resolvió el problema. Si lo sabes, por favor comenta!
Inspirado por la respuesta de @ sbugert, comencé a buscar otros demonios del sistema que podrían funcionar si se reinicia. Como un disparo en la oscuridad que maté coreservicesd
. Esto hizo que el sistema operativo se volviera visiblemente inestable y finalmente me desconecté automáticamente. Para mi sorpresa, cuando volví a iniciar sesión, mi interfaz de audio fue reconocida.
En base a eso, planteé la hipótesis de que matar coreservicesd
y cerrar sesión / iniciar sesión puede ser una posible solución (fea). Así que desconecté la interfaz y la volví a enchufar, y como era de esperar, no se reconoció. Así que maté a coreservicesd e intenté cerrar sesión, sin embargo, no pude hacer que el sistema se desconectara debido a la inestabilidad causada por matar a coreservicesd. Finalmente me vi obligado a hacer un apagado "duro" (es decir, mantener presionado el botón de encendido hasta que se apaga). Después de reiniciar el macbook nuevamente, la interfaz ahora se reconoce automáticamente cada vez que la conecto. Sospecho que este reinicio "duro" puede haber resuelto el problema sin todas las travesuras con el demonio coreservices, pero no tengo forma de probarlo. .
Si alguien puede arrojar luz sobre esto, ¡hazlo!
Settings > Sound
y verificar que la Salida esté configurada correctamente.Intenta escribir esto en la Terminal:
Esto matará el proceso de coreaudio y lo reiniciará.
fuente
La misma solución pero con diferentes variaciones.
fuente
kill -9
solo por el hecho de hacerlo. Un desnudokill
es perfectamente suficiente para detener al demonio en circunstancias normales. El uso indiscriminado de-9
puede conducir a situaciones en las que un demonio se apaga tan brutalmente que ya no puede reiniciarlo.Aquí he descubierto que si selecciono otro dispositivo antes de desconectar la interfaz (también Fast Track C400), puedo conectarlo nuevamente más tarde sin ningún problema. Pero si estoy usando la vía rápida y luego la desconecto, no se puede volver a conectar hasta que la reinicie.
fuente